Which ski would you pick for a long distance endurance race (100 miles) on snowmobile trails with rolling terrain (climbs up to 8-10%)? The goal is to finish as quickly as possible.

I’m primarily interested in hearing opinions on how the twin skin performs compared to the mono skin on the Madshus Fjelltech.

I’ve skied the Madshus Fjelltech and personally find them a bit soft and slow.

I’ve not skied the Fischer Transnordic 59’s but have access to them.

Both have a Move binding.

I’ve skied on Asnes Mtn Race 48’s before as well. Where would you rank these in comparison to the other two?

I did the race last year on a pair of Asnes Otto Sverdrup’s and will have them in reserve if the weather calls for a wider ski. I found the wax maintenance ended up being quite cumbersome after the first 50 miles as the variation in temp throughout a long time period made things tricky.
